A good idea
Companies should not promise what they can't deliver. Balmer is just making the prudent decision of making sure he doesn't lose any more trust than he already has by being honest with his customers.

As for people who signed up for SA, well sorry, but you made a bad decision. You should never make a decision based on what a vendor promises what they will achieve years in the future. I'm sure they intended to make good, but they were mistaken. Now if you want to punish that vendor by taking your business elsewhere, then that's your prerogative. But remember, you wouldn't be in this mess if you hadn't made a bed decision yourself.
